    I purchased this bowl from a dealer in mixed wares. It is 6 3/4" in diameter at the top, 3 1/2" tall. It was molded/thrown by hand. The base was finished with a tool that incised the clay. There is a roughly incised spiral in the center of the base. I would love to know where and roughly when this was made. On-line research suggests this is Swatow ware from China.
